London-based, Israeli-born artist Oreet Ashery and Copenhagen-based, Palestinian-born artist Larissa Sansour present a program about The Novel of Nonel and Vovel (Charta, 2009), their experimental graphic novel that addresses art, politics, and the future of Palestine. The event includes an artist dialogue, a film screening, and a talk by curator and art historian Reem Fadda. A book signing will follow.

 

Saturday, January 23, 2010
2 p.m.
Iris and B. Gerald Cantor Auditorium, 3rd Floor
